Q: Is 801,278 a Prime Number?
A: No, 801,278 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 801278 can be evenly divided by 1 2 17 34 23,567 47,134 400,639 and 801,278, with no remainder.
Since 801,278 cannot be divided by just 1 and 801,278, it is not a prime number.
